## Deployment

The GarageSense occupancy feed deploys from the `stallwatch` pipeline to the Bremerton cluster. Support only needs to restart the feed worker when sensor counts freeze for more than ten minutes; escalate anything else to the Kerbside platform team. Before restarting, verify the worker picked up the current settings, listed below for reference.

config for bajog-yahag:
QUENIX_HOST=quenix.zemvarsys.internal
QUENIX_PORT=8443

Meeting notes (excerpt) — Brinemarsh backfill review

We walked through the Lanternjack scheduler changes: partition ordering is now deterministic, and the retry queue persists across restarts. Reviewer should check the lease-renewal logic carefully, since a missed renewal previously caused double-running backfills. Test coverage was added for the midnight-boundary case. Agreed that any merge touching the cron parser needs explicit sign-off. The accountable approver for this module is named below.

approver of faduf-bagug = Framir Sorwyn

Our static-analysis setup at Brindleworks uses a committed baseline file, lintfloor.json, generated by the Gritcheck tool. The baseline freezes all pre-existing findings so CI only fails on new issues. Future maintainers should regenerate it only after a deliberate cleanup sprint, never to silence a failing build. Regeneration requires write access to the Gritcheck config vault, which is protected by a recovery account reserved for maintainers. The passphrase for that account is recorded on the following line.

vault phrase of bahap-hahop = novath-fenir-tamion-kelath-ruswyn

Subject: PickPath cut-over recap

Hi future maintainers,

We cut the warehouse pick-list optimizer over to the new routing engine on Sunday. Pick times dropped about 12% in the first shift, and the old engine is now read-only for comparisons until end of month. Two things to know: batching logic moved server-side, and the aisle-weighting model retrains nightly. If you're debugging odd route choices, start with the live settings, which as of the cut-over are:

service settings:
PRAIX_LOG_LEVEL=error
PRAIX_METRICS_HOST=metrics.praix.qorvelcorp.corp
PRAIX_POOL_SIZE=16